SCOTTSBORO, Ala. According to the Jackson County Sheriff's Office: On Friday February 23, 2018, the Jackson County Sheriff’s Office Narcotics Unit received information of possible drug activity at a local motel on Micah Way (near Walmart) in Scottsboro, Alabama.

Narcotics Investigators went to the location where a search of a room was conducted along with a search of a vehicle belonging to the occupant of the room. During the search of the vehicle Investigators located Methamphetamine, Synthetic Cannabinoids (Spice) and Drug Paraphernalia.

Arrested in connection with this investigation was Sandy LeAnn Chambers age 25 of Sulligent, Alabama who was charged with Unlawful Possession of Controlled Substances-(Methamphetamine), Unlawful Possession of Controlled Substances-(Spice) and Unlawful Possession of Drug Paraphernalia.

Chambers remains in the Jackson County Jail on $10,300 bond.
